A Health Care FSA (HCFSA) is a pre-tax benefit account that's used to pay for eligible medical, dental, and vision care expenses that are not covered by your health care plan or elsewhere. With an HCFSA, you use pre-tax dollars to pay for qualified out-of-pocket health care expenses. View all FAQs. With an HCFSA, you use pre-tax dollars to pay for qualified out-of-pocket health care expenses. View all FAQs. Yes, mileage to and from a medical service is an eligible Health Care FSA expense. For the 2024 benefit period, the mileage rate is 21 cents per mile. The deadline to submit mileage claims from the 2024 benefit period is April 30, 2025. Unlike some other benefits, FSAFEDS enrollments do not renew automatically each year. Participants must actively enroll each Open Season if they wish to have a flexible spending account in the next year. To enroll, visit the FSAFEDS website or call 1-877-FSAFEDS (372-3337).
